#261457 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#261457 is composed of 14.9% red, 7.8%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.3% cyan, 77%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 256.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 21%. #261457 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c28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#261457 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#261457 has RGB values of R:38, G:20,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 2495575.

Shades and Tints of #261457

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030207 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#261457

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353536 is the less saturated color, while #1e0467 is the most saturated one.
